>Package: youtube-dl
>Version: 2020.01.24-0.1
>Severity: normal
>
>youtube-dl recommends phantomjs, which pulls in hundreds of megabytes
>of
>Qt libraries.
>
>Phantomjs is seemingly used only for fetching resources from pornhub
>(YoutubeDL.py checks if that and rtmpdump exist but uses neither).
>
>Since pornhub is only one out of [too lazy to count] places youtube-dl
>supports, I dare say that it is the ideal use for "Suggests" rather
>than
>"Recommends".
